Transaction 944910781c678892023600284164576bf3bab719fc92ba0469bcac4b3ef6d7f6
1 Input
1 Outputs
- 944910781c678892023600284164576bf3bab719fc92ba0469bcac4b3ef6d7f6:0
value 43487
address 19TzpyHEmJzq19UWdLFJT2SC9LyUiG15KY